Windjammer Marketplace: Windjammer Marketplace serves as the main buffet dining option on Deck 11. It offers diverse international cuisines for breakfast, lunch, and dinner. Guests can enjoy various local and global dishes, ranging from salads to desserts.
-
El Loco Fresh: El Loco Fresh presents a casual dining experience featuring Mexican cuisine. The menu includes tacos, burritos, and quesadillas. This venue encourages guests to customize their meals with fresh toppings and salsas.
-
Park Café: Park Café is a quick-service eatery known for its salads, sandwiches, and grab-and-go options. It specializes in fresh ingredients and offers a variety of healthy choices. Guests can enjoy daytime meals in a relaxed atmosphere.
-
Sorrento’s Pizza: Sorrento’s Pizza offers freshly baked pizza options. It provides a selection of classic and unique toppings. Guests can grab a slice at any time, making it a popular choice for casual dining.
-
Johnny Rockets: Johnny Rockets is a classic American diner. It serves hamburgers, fries, and milkshakes in a nostalgic setting. The lively atmosphere and entertaining waitstaff enhance the dining experience.
